    Cory P.

    Three words, Bacon, Bourbon and Brews! I was fortunate enough to win a pair of tickets from the Yelp Giveaway and asked one of my room mates to accompany me! It was a wonderful experience that supported such a great cause. The event was held at Wingfield Park and boy was it lively! After receiving our passes on a blue CARE Chest lanyard, we made our way into the venue. Live music was being played by a band that goes by the name of Escalade. Our first thought was to sample some beers and stand in ilne for the food! There was several breweries (Brewers Cabinet, Lead Dog, Imbib, Alaskan, Pigeon Head, The Depot, Sierra Nevada, Great Basin, Breakthru Beverage Nevada, and Under the Rose) and a couple of distilleries (Branded Hearts, Frey Ranch Estates, Verdi Local, Foresaken River, Seven Troughs, 10 Torr Distillery and Brewery, and Bulliet Wiskey). We both weren't huge bourbon fans, but for the experience, we tried Frey Ranch's Maple Old Fashion with Candied Bacon. Like I said, I'm not a huge fan of bourbon, but the candied bacon was delicious! We're more beer drinkers, so we definitely had our fair share of beers! Onto my favorite part, the food. The food was catered by Mari Chuy's Mexican Kitchen and my goodness...everything was tasty. They had a whole roasted suckling pig and the meat was almost gone! So we headed there first before standing in the food line. I made sure to grab a piece of crispy skin too. The food line had tacos, pulled pork, pork and beans, stuffed peppers, churros, potato and Cesar salad with bacon in it. Everything and I mean everything was scrumptious! The stuffed peppers were a bit spicy, but that didn't deter me. After eating, we walked down the auction table to see what they had. The event was also having a Burning Man Raffle. We wanted to support CARE Chest and since we didn't pay for our admission tickets, we decided to support them by purchasing an "arm pull" of tickets ($40). Another band called The Beatles Flashback played and they were absolutely entertaining. My dad loves the Beatles so I grew up listening to their songs as well. It was great to see the audience singing and dancing along to those famous hits. Bacon, Bourbon, and Brews was such a lovely experience. The event was well organized with great live music, tasty food, and refreshing drinks. It also felt great to have contributed to CARE Chest. I'd say this event was a complete success and I am glad we were able to be a part of it.
